The foundation of this gravy lies in the unique treatment of dried mushrooms. Freezing the mushrooms before grinding them into a fine powder allows for a delicate texture that seamlessly integrates into the gravy, acting as a natural thickener. This mushroom powder is then carefully toasted, a crucial step that amplifies the natural glutamates, deepening the umami profile and introducing complex, roasted notes. This process eliminates the need for additional starches, contributing to a smooth and flavorful base. Following this, aromatic elements such as fresh thyme, rosemary, and sage are sautéed in coconut oil, releasing their essential oils and infusing the gravy with a classic, woodsy essence. Shallots and garlic are added to this fragrant mixture, softening and sweetening as they cook, further enhancing the gravy's depth. Full-fat coconut milk is then introduced, providing a luxurious creaminess and body, with its subtle sweetness balanced by the savory and herbaceous components. Finally, the gravy is completed with both light and dark soy sauces; the former boosting its overall savory character, and the latter adding a touch of color and a hint of molasses for visual appeal and an extra layer of flavor. After simmering to perfection, the gravy is strained to achieve a silky consistency, then finished with Dijon mustard and optional nutmeg, culminating in a complex, aromatic, and deeply satisfying vegan gravy.
